Demi Lovato just said no...to a couple of X Factor hopefuls who rapped about doing drugs earlier today during their audition for the Fox show.

"She wasn't having any of it," a source confirms to E! News of what went down in Greensboro, N.C. "She said 'It's really irresponsible to be rapping about drugs in front of kids.' Then they tried to make excuses and Demi said, 'You talked about bath salts, I heard you.'"

Bath salts, if you don't know, is an addictive synthetic powder that has the same effects as cocaine and crystal meth. And it just so happens that President Barack Obama signed new legislation yesterday that bans two chemical compounds in the United States that are used to make bath salts.

Lovato told the young rappers to leave the stage, the source said, and the "rest of the judges completely backed her."

The audience also booed the duo.

The 19-year-old hitmaker has made no secret about her past use of drugs and alcohol and a stint in rehab two years ago for emotional issues.

She told Seventeen magazine in January that she thinks "sober is sexy."

At the time, she also told E! News, "Now I cherish a whole new meaning to my career, which is to be an inspiration. I think I've been given a voice for a reason...Everything happened for a reason and it's no coincidence that I've been put through a lot at such a young age."
